Kuching vs Goteborg-Save Climate & Distance Between

Sweden flag
  • The distance between Kuching, Malaysia and Goteborg-Save, Sweden is approximately 10,368 km or 6,443 mi.
  • To reach Kuching in this distance one would set out from Goteborg-Save bearing 82°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Kuching bearing 148.1° or SSE .
  • Kuching has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Goteborg-Save has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Kuching is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ome whereas Goteborg-Save is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 19 °C (34.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.3 °C (29.3°F) less in Kuching.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 3378.3 mm (133 in) more which is equivalent to 3378.3 l/m² (82.91 US gal/ft²) or 33,783,000 l/ha (3,611,627 US gal/ac) more. About 5 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 42.4° higher in Kuching than in Goteborg-Save.
